Definitions:

Sympathetic Nervous System

A part of the autonomic nervous system that prepares the body for quick response to stressful situations.

Respiration

The biochemical process in living organisms involving the ex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ide between the organism and its environment.

Sympathetic Nervous System

A branch of the autonomic nervous system that activates what is often termed the fight or flight response during times of stress.

Physiological Reactions

The body's automatic responses to external or internal stimuli, which can include changes in heart rate, blood pressure, and hormone levels.
